- [ ] Step 7: Archive cold storage buckets (Glacierline tier). Confirm both ceremony witnesses are present, verify bucket manifests match the Oxbow ledger, then seal the archive key shares. Plugin authors may observe but not handle shares. Once sealed, the archive index itself is encrypted and can only be reopened with the passphrase below.

vault phrase of badup-hahig = tamael-aldael-kelmir-istael-fenok-istwyn-tamius-jorath-oliion

Onboarding note for the Ledgerpane admin table: bulk edits are applied through the batcher service, not directly against the database. Select rows, choose an action, and the batcher stages changes in a pending set you can review before commit. Edits over 500 rows require a second approver — this is enforced server-side, so don't try to chunk around it. To run the batcher locally you need the staging write credential, which goes in your .env as the next line.

secret setting of bahip-kagag: RELAY_SECRET3=c83

Ticket #—Front desk visitor handling, Tollbridge House. Team assistants must pre-register all guests the day before and meet them in the lobby; visitors cannot roam unescorted past the turnstiles. Badge printer at reception is now working again. To release visitor badges and open the inner lobby door, use the access code below.

turnstile pass: bdg-YPPQB-52010